10-Step Action Plan

  1. Create a printable bundle titled “Audiophile Chaos Coordinator.”
  2. Design listening session sheets with ratings for clarity, soundstage, bass response, and “instant goosebumps.”
  3. Add humorous sliders like “Wallet danger level.”
  4. Create a room-to-room tracking map so attendees remember where they heard each demo.
  5. Include gear comparison charts for speakers, DACs, headphones, and amps.
  6. Add a networking tracker labeled “People Who Speak Fluent Decibel.”
  7. Include a “Buzzword Bingo” page for phrases like “warm analog tone.”
  8. Create a purchase planning sheet to prevent impulsive audio spending (or encourage it – your choice).
  9. Export both printable PDF and tablet-fillable versions.
  10. Bundle bonus sheets like home setup planners and cable management sketches.
